数据库服务器有什么技术

worktile 其他 2

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库服务器是用于存储、管理和处理大量数据的服务器,它提供了各种技术和功能来支持数据的安全性、可靠性和高效性。以下是数据库服务器常用的技术:

    1. 数据库管理系统(DBMS):数据库服务器使用DBMS来管理和操作数据库。常见的DBMS包括MySQL、Oracle、SQL Server和PostgreSQL等。这些DBMS提供了丰富的功能,如数据存储、查询、事务处理、备份和恢复等。

    2. 分布式数据库:分布式数据库是将数据分布在多台服务器上的数据库系统。它可以提高数据库的可扩展性和性能。常见的分布式数据库技术包括MySQL Cluster、Cassandra和MongoDB等。

    3. 数据复制和高可用性:数据库服务器通常需要提供数据的冗余备份,以确保数据的安全性和可用性。数据复制是将数据从一个服务器复制到另一个服务器的过程,以实现数据的冗余备份。常见的数据复制技术包括主从复制和多主复制。此外,数据库服务器还可以使用故障切换技术来实现高可用性,例如主备切换和集群技术。

    4. 数据库性能优化:数据库服务器需要提供高效的数据访问和处理能力。为了提高数据库的性能,可以采取一系列优化措施,如索引优化、查询优化、缓存机制、分区和分表等。此外,数据库服务器还可以使用负载均衡技术来分散数据库的访问压力,提高性能和可扩展性。

    5. 数据安全和权限管理:数据库服务器需要提供数据的安全性和权限管理功能。常见的安全措施包括用户身份验证、访问控制、数据加密、审计和日志记录等。数据库服务器还可以使用防火墙和入侵检测系统来保护数据免受恶意攻击。

    总之,数据库服务器是支持数据管理和处理的关键基础设施,它使用各种技术来提供高效、可靠和安全的数据库服务。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库服务器是一种专门用于存储和管理数据的服务器。它使用数据库管理系统(DBMS)来处理数据的创建、读取、更新和删除操作。数据库服务器的技术主要包括以下几个方面:

    1. 数据库管理系统(DBMS):数据库服务器使用DBMS来管理和操作数据库。常见的DBMS包括MySQL、Oracle、SQL Server、PostgreSQL等。不同的DBMS具有不同的特点和功能,可以根据具体需求选择合适的DBMS。

    2. 数据库设计:数据库服务器需要进行数据库的设计,包括确定数据表的结构、字段类型、索引等。合理的数据库设计可以提高数据的存储效率和查询性能。

    3. 数据库索引:数据库服务器使用索引来加快数据的查询速度。索引是根据某个或多个字段对数据进行排序的数据结构,可以快速定位到满足特定条件的数据。

    4. 数据备份与恢复:数据库服务器需要定期进行数据备份,以防止数据丢失或损坏。备份可以通过全量备份和增量备份来进行,以保证数据的完整性和可恢复性。

    5. 数据库性能优化:数据库服务器需要进行性能优化,以提高数据库的查询速度和吞吐量。常见的性能优化手段包括合理设计数据库结构、优化SQL语句、使用合适的索引、调整数据库参数等。

    6. 数据库安全:数据库服务器需要保护数据的安全性,防止数据泄露和未经授权的访问。常见的安全措施包括设置数据库用户和权限、加密敏感数据、定期审计数据库等。

    7. 数据库集群与分布式:为了提高数据库的可用性和扩展性,数据库服务器可以采用集群或分布式架构。数据库集群将数据分布在多个节点上,实现数据的冗余和负载均衡;分布式数据库将数据分布在多个地理位置上,实现数据的分片和跨地域访问。

    综上所述,数据库服务器的技术主要包括数据库管理系统、数据库设计、数据库索引、数据备份与恢复、数据库性能优化、数据库安全以及数据库集群与分布式等方面。这些技术可以帮助数据库服务器提供高效、安全、可靠的数据存储和管理服务。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库服务器是指专门用于存储和管理大量数据的服务器。它采用了一系列技术来提供高效的数据存储和访问能力。以下是一些常见的数据库服务器技术:

    1. 数据库管理系统(DBMS):数据库服务器使用DBMS来管理数据库。DBMS是一种软件,它提供了创建、操作和维护数据库的功能。常见的DBMS包括MySQL、Oracle、Microsoft SQL Server、PostgreSQL等。

    2. 数据库设计:在构建数据库服务器之前,需要进行数据库设计。这包括确定数据结构、定义表和字段、建立关系等。数据库设计的目标是保证数据的一致性、完整性和安全性。

    3. 数据库语言:数据库服务器使用特定的语言来处理和查询数据。SQL(Structured Query Language)是最常用的数据库语言。它可以用于创建表、插入数据、更新数据、删除数据以及查询数据。

    4. 数据库索引:索引是数据库服务器中的一种数据结构,用于提高数据检索速度。索引可以根据某个列或一组列的值进行排序和搜索,从而加快查询操作的速度。

    5. 数据备份和恢复:数据库服务器提供数据备份和恢复功能,以防止数据丢失或损坏。备份是将数据库中的数据复制到另一个地方,以便在需要时进行恢复。常见的备份方法包括完全备份、增量备份和差异备份。

    6. 数据库复制:数据库服务器可以通过复制数据来提高性能和可用性。复制是将数据库服务器中的数据复制到其他服务器上,从而实现数据的冗余存储和负载均衡。常见的复制方法包括主从复制和多主复制。

    7. 数据库集群:数据库服务器可以通过集群来提供更高的性能和可用性。数据库集群是由多个服务器组成的集合,它们共同处理数据库请求。常见的数据库集群技术包括主从复制、多主复制和分布式数据库。

    8. 数据库性能调优:数据库服务器需要进行性能调优以提高查询和事务处理的速度。性能调优包括优化查询语句、创建索引、调整缓存大小、优化表结构等。

    总结起来,数据库服务器的技术包括数据库管理系统、数据库设计、数据库语言、数据库索引、数据备份和恢复、数据库复制、数据库集群以及数据库性能调优等。这些技术共同提供了高效的数据存储和访问能力,满足了不同应用场景下的数据管理需求。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部